RS-485 Modbus/DNP3 RTU communications enable seamless integration with PLCs and SCADA systems, reducing wiring and commissioning time while enabling remote diagnostics. This translates to faster fault isolation and improved asset utilization in motor control panels and distributed drive architectures. IRIG-B time synchronization and URTD interface provide precise timing and data routing for coordinated protection across multiple devices, enhancing selectivity in complex automation lines and minimizing nuisance tripping. The device includes voltage protection and metering, current protection and metering, delivering actionable energy data and improved fault analytics to support maintenance planning and energy efficiency programs. Conformal coated circuit boards boost reliability in dusty or humid environments, reducing field failures and service calls while extending MTBF in outdoor or harsh factory settings. With 8 digital inputs, 5 digital outputs, and 4 analog outputs, plus 1 zone-selective interlocking (ZSIL) option, engineers gain flexible control topology for motor start/stop sequencing and safety interlocks.
